c) Flame Failure - Re-ignition
1. If the established flame signal is lost
while
the burner is operating, the control will
respond within 0.8 seconds. The high
voltage spark will be energized for a trial
for ignition period in an attempt to re-
light the burner.
14. LIGHTING INSTRUCTIONS
Refer to the lighting instructions on the out-
side cover of the burner housing. Again, if
the unit goes off on safety, turn thermostat
OFF for 30 seconds before the heater can be
restarted.

15. RECOMMENDED MAINTENANCE

1. Inspect the venting system every heating
season and repair or replace worn parts as
required.
2. Check the inlet air opening and the
blower periodically, and clean off any lint
or
foreign matter.
